The UC2845AD8TR is a high-frequency switching regulator, and as such, proper PCB layout and design are crucial for optimal performance. TI recommends a multi-layer PCB with a solid ground plane, and careful placement of components to minimize noise and EMI. A good rule of thumb is to keep the switching node (pins 3 and 4) as close to the output filter components as possible, and to use a separate analog and power ground plane.
The choice of inductor value and type depends on the specific application requirements, such as output voltage, current, and switching frequency. TI recommends using an inductor with a high saturation current rating, low DC resistance, and a suitable core material (e.g., ferrite or iron powder). A good starting point is to use the inductor value and type recommended in the datasheet, and then adjust based on the specific application requirements.
The UC2845AD8TR has an absolute maximum input voltage rating of 18V, but the recommended maximum operating input voltage is 15V. Exceeding this voltage can cause damage to the device or affect its performance.
To ensure stability, TI recommends following the compensation network design guidelines in the datasheet, and using a suitable output capacitor with low ESR. Additionally, it's essential to ensure that the input voltage is within the recommended range, and that the device is properly decoupled with ceramic capacitors.

About Texas Instruments
Texas Instruments (TI) designs and manufactures semiconductors and integrated circuits for a wide range of applications. The company's product portfolio includes analog chips, which are essential for managing power and signal functions in electronic devices, and embedded processors, which serve as the brains in various systems, enabling functionality in everything from industrial equipment to consumer electronics. TI's innovations in semiconductor technology have made it a leader in the industry.
